

在移动链端用户体验里,TP钱包未显示币价既是界面缺陷,也是底层生态链路暴露的信号。本文以白皮书式的逻辑结构展开,目标在于把问题拆解成可验证的层级,并提出工程与策略并行的修复路径。
分析流程(方法论):1) 数据收集:采集客户端日志、网络请求、Token 列表和链上事件;2) 环境复现:在主网/测试网、不同节点和不同版本复现问题;3) 溯源判定:比对价格 API、DEX 池深度、Oracles、Token metadata(symbol/decimals/contract)是否一致;4) 依赖映射:列出所有外部服务(CoinGecko/CMC/DEX/自建Oracle);5) 风险评估:评估可用性、延迟、合规与隐私影响;6) 修复验证:灰度发布并监控指标。
合约库与价格源技术:常见原因包括Token未被映射到内部合约库、ERC20/兼容标准差异、decimals错误或合约代理模式导致的地址解析失败。价格获取通常依赖中心化API(CoinGecko/CMC)或去中心化价格聚合(Uniswap/Sushi/DEX 路径、TWAP、Chainlink)。建议采用双通道策略:优先本地缓存的价格映射与异步刷新;关键资产使用链上Oracles与DEX即时路径作为兜底,并建立TokenList标准化仓库以避免符号冲突。
支付解决方案与高效支付服务:钱包展示价格与支付链路相关,常见优化包括Gas抽象、Meta-transactions、Layer2支付渠道与批处理结算。对于商家和服务端,采用可验证的链上收款(事件+确认数)并辅以稳定币结算能降低价格波动带来的 UX断层;使用Rollup或状态通道可实现毫秒级确认与低费率,提升“显示可支付金额”的实时性。
矿池、行业剖析与匿名币:矿池影响网络出块与手续费波动,间接影响价格查询延迟与DEX深度。匿名币(如Monero/Zcash型)往往被中心化行情源部分屏蔽或因合规因素流动性不足,导致钱包难以找到可靠价格。对于匿名资产,建议用DEX成交数据或OTC行情作为补偿信息,同时在UI明确标注数据来源与可信度。
建议汇总:建立健全的Token元数据注册与同步链路、混合价格策略(中心化API+去中心化Oracles)、容错的UI设计(本地缓存、离线提示)、以及对隐私币与低流动性资产的专门处理策略。同时把监控、告警与回滚机制嵌入发布流程。解决TP钱包币价不显示不是单一补丁,而要在合约库治理、价格基础设施与支付技术间搭一条可观测、可追溯并具备合规弹性的桥梁,这将提升钱包在多元数字金融场景下的稳定性与信任度。
评论